Just a quick exploratory post really, and I thought I should at least offer it up here ahead of going to eBay, pistonheads etc...

The time has come to part ways with the white Phase 1, due to finally finding my 'dream-spec' black phase 2, and the need for something a bit newer and dependable for the daily commute (plus I've felt a bit cruel using the 16v during winter months).

With a full ticket and some of the little niggly problems sorted, I'd be asking for £1200. It's been well looked after and had a fair amount of money spent on it (More than I care to think about :oops: ). Just a few weeks ago it had a new alternator and the cambelt/waterpump/tensioners were done last year, as well as a full set of silicone coolant hoses. I will write a more comprehensive description later...

However... I really need to get it shifted reasonably quickly, and would consider selling it 'as is' for less money in the next week or so. MoT is up in mid-April, and it's taxed until the end of March. The car is still in daily use, and is ready to go, with no major problems.

Niggles include things like lazy central locking actuators, lazy drivers side window and a slow front wiper. I also need to paint the front bumper as I fitted a brand new unpainted bumper (the old one had been badly painted in the past, and had been scuffed in the past by the looks of things). It also recently lost it's rear exhaust hanger, and will need the appropriate repairs doing.

Rear corrosion is not too bad, like I said it will be repaired pre- proper sale and have been quoted about £150 to do. Like everything, it's probably worse than it looks, but not something that worries me too much.

The fact any prospective BX 16v owner will have to come to terms with is fighting rust. It is a 24 year old car after all! This one is in fair shape, probably one of the better ones, especially for a phase 1. More importantly its usable - and has been in regular use.
